一种生成签名的方法和装置、安全认证方法和装置

    公开(公告)号:CN115834085A

    公开(公告)日:2023-03-21

    申请号:CN202211545380.8

    申请日:2022-12-05

    Abstract: 本公开的实施例提供一种生成签名的方法,具体实现方案为:接收基于身份信息和公开参数生成的用户私钥;响应于用户私钥的验证结果正确,确定用户私钥合法;响应于接收到待签名数据,从联盟区块链获取公开参数;基于公开参数、待签名数据、签名时间以及用户私钥,生成包括待签名数据的签名;将签名发送给联盟区块链上的接收者,以使接收者基于公开参数检测签名的合法性。通过本实施方式,提高了签名生成的安全性。

    一种短信加密方法及短信解密方法

    公开(公告)号:CN118900411A

    公开(公告)日:2024-11-05

    申请号:CN202410991784.2

    申请日:2024-07-23

    Abstract: 本申请实施例公开了一种短信加密方法及短信解密方法,用于提高短信传输消息的安全性。本申请实施例方法包括:获取待发送的短信内容;利用预设哈希算法对所述短信内容执行哈希运算,生成第一信息摘要;利用本机的私钥对所述第一信息摘要执行加密,得到数字签名;生成会话密钥,所述会话密钥为对称性密钥;利用所述会话密钥对所述短信内容进行加密,得到短信密文;利用预先存储在本地数据库的所述第二设备的公钥对所述会话密钥进行加密,得到会话密钥密文;将所述会话密钥密文、所述短信密文、所述数字签名以短信的形式向所述第二设备发送。

Patent Agency Ranking